Naughty Dog’s Druckmann Urges Patience In Waiting For Studios’ Next Project

Strap in, because it's probably going to be awhile.

Last year saw the release of the much anticipated The Last of Us Part 2 from Sony and Naughty Dog, which was heaped with tons of critical acclaim and high sales. As you’d expect, fans are eager to see what the developer will be doing next, but they will have to be patience.

On his official Twitter, Naughty Dog Co-President Neil Druckmann told people asking about future projects that they would have to be patient. He promised that there were several “cool” things to share, which they would do as soon as possible, but sounds like it could very well be a good while before we get them.

As it stands now, no one is sure what the studio is working on. Whether they will continue with a third The Last of Us, a fifth Uncharted or an entirely new property is really anyone’s guess. There’s also a multiplayer mode that was talked about for The Last of Us Part 2, but it’s unclear if Naughty Dog will be the one doing it. In the end, we’ll just have to have patience.
